Tetrathiafulvalene‐amido‐2‐pyridine‐N‐oxide as Efficient Charge‐Transfer Antenna Ligand for the Sensitization of YbIII Luminescence in a Series of Lanthanide Paramagnetic Coordination Complexes

Abstract: The tetrathiafulvalene-amido-2-pyridine-N-oxide (L) ligand has been employed to coordinate 4f elements. The architecture of the complexes mainly depends on the ionic radii of the lanthanides. Thus, the reaction of L in the same experimental protocol leads to three different molecular structure series. Binuclear [Ln(2)(hfac)(5)(O(2)CPhCl)(L)(3)]·2 H(2)O (hfac(-)=1,1,1,5,5,5-hexafluoroacetylacetonate anion, O(2)CPhCl(-)=3-chlorobenzoate anion) and mononuclear [Ln(hfac)(3)(L)(2)] complexes were obtained by using … Show more
